腾讯应用服务器建设网站需要购买数据库吗?

在腾讯云上使用应用服务器建设网站时,是否需要购买数据库取决于您的具体需求和项目规模。如果您的网站仅需处理少量静态数据或简单的文件存储,可能无需额外购买数据库服务;但若涉及动态内容管理、用户信息存储、订单记录等复杂操作,则建议单独购买数据库服务以确保性能与安全性。

分析与探讨

  1. 静态网站 vs 动态网站
    如果您正在构建的是一个静态网站(如个人博客或企业展示页面),所有内容都可以通过HTML、CSS和JavaScript实现,并且不需要频繁更新数据,那么可以不购买独立的数据库服务。腾讯云提供的对象存储COS或其他云文件存储服务即可满足需求。然而,如果是动态网站(例如电商系统、社交平台或内容管理系统CMS),则需要一个高效稳定的数据库来支持后端逻辑运行及数据交互。

  2. 内置数据库功能的局限性
    部分轻量级应用服务器可能自带基础版数据库(如MySQL或SQLite)。对于初期开发测试阶段来说,这已经足够应付小规模流量。但是由于访问量增加以及业务复杂度提升,这些内置解决方案可能会暴露出性能瓶颈问题,比如响应速度变慢、并发处理能力不足等。此时选择专业化的数据库产品就显得尤为重要了。

  3. 腾讯云数据库的优势
    腾讯云提供了多种类型的数据库服务,包括关系型数据库TencentDB(支持MySQL、PostgreSQL等多种引擎)、文档型数据库MongoDB、键值对存储Redis等。相比自行搭建和维护数据库实例,直接选用云服务商提供的标准化产品具有以下好处:

    • 高可用性:通过主从复制、自动备份机制保障数据安全性和可靠性;
    • 弹性扩展:根据实际负载情况灵活调整资源配置,避免资源浪费;
    • 运维简化:由专业团队负责日常监控、补丁更新等工作,降低技术门槛;
    • 兼容性强:支持主流编程语言接口连接,便于快速集成进现有架构中。
  4. 成本考量
    虽然单独购买数据库会增加一定支出,但从长远来看,在正确评估需求的前提下投入这笔费用是值得的。它可以帮助企业避免因基础设施不稳定而导致的服务中断风险,同时提高整体用户体验满意度。此外,腾讯云经常推出优惠活动,合理规划预算也能有效控制开支。

综上所述,当您的网站项目超出单纯静态展示范畴,进入更深层次的数据管理和交互领域时,确实有必要考虑在腾讯云上单独购买合适的数据库服务。这样不仅能够增强系统的稳定性和效率,也为未来可能发生的业务扩张预留充足空间。

未经允许不得转载:CCLOUD博客 » 腾讯应用服务器建设网站需要购买数据库吗?